SuperMap iDesktopX 实战:三步解锁高德POI数据,赋能地理信息应用

张开发
2026/4/18 23:00:20 15 分钟阅读

分享文章

SuperMap iDesktopX 实战:三步解锁高德POI数据,赋能地理信息应用
1. 为什么你需要掌握高德POI数据获取技能作为一名GIS分析师或数据工程师相信你经常遇到这样的场景老板突然要求分析某区域的商业分布情况或者规划部门急需某类公共设施的服务覆盖范围报告。这时候POIPoint of Interest数据就成了解决问题的关键。POI简单理解就是地图上的兴趣点比如餐饮店、学校、医院这些具体位置信息。传统获取POI数据的方式要么费时费力比如人工采集要么成本高昂购买商业数据。而高德地图开放的API接口就像打开了一扇新世界的大门——免费、海量、实时更新的POI数据任你取用。但问题来了直接调用API需要编写代码对非程序员来说门槛太高而市面上现成的工具又往往操作复杂学习成本大。这就是为什么我要推荐SuperMap iDesktopX的POI数据下载插件。它把复杂的API调用过程封装成了三个傻瓜式操作步骤就像把专业单反相机变成了一键美颜的智能手机。我去年负责一个城市商业综合体选址项目时就用这个插件在半小时内搞定了周边3公里范围内所有竞品商铺的POI数据比团队原先预计的2天人工采集时间快了整整10倍。2. 准备工作安装插件与获取密钥2.1 插件安装的详细指南打开SuperMap iDesktopX建议使用10.2.1及以上版本别急着找插件入口。很多新手会犯的第一个错误就是直接在菜单栏乱翻——其实插件管理藏在【视图】选项卡里。点击后会出现插件管理器窗口这里有个实用技巧在搜索框输入POI能快速定位到目标插件。安装过程中可能会遇到两个常见问题网络超时导致安装失败特别是公司网络有防火墙时插件版本与桌面版本不兼容针对第一个问题我建议切换手机热点重试第二个问题则需要检查插件版本号。最新版的POI数据下载插件v1.2.3完美适配iDesktopX 10.2.1。安装完成后必须重启软件这个步骤很多人会忽略结果发现找不到新功能。2.2 高德Key申请避坑指南点击插件界面密钥参数旁的小问号图标会跳转到高德开放平台。这里要特别注意个人开发者选择Web服务类型而不是Web端后者是给网页开发用的。申请时需要企业邮箱验证但实测用个人邮箱也能通过。我踩过的一个坑刚开始随便填了个应用名称test结果第二天Key就被封了。后来才知道高德会检测低质量应用建议填写真实项目名称如XX市商业分析系统。每个Key默认每天有3000次免费调用额度对于区域POI采集完全够用。如果要做全国范围采集可以用多个手机号注册多个账号分散请求。3. 参数配置的艺术精准获取目标数据3.1 城市编码的智能选择技巧下载高德提供的城市编码表后不要直接用Excel打开——中文字符可能会出现乱码。建议用WPS或专业文本编辑器查看。编码表里有三个关键字段中文名如北京市朝阳区adcode如110105citycode如010实际使用时有个隐藏技巧当采集范围是市级以下区域时建议同时填写adcode和中文名用竖线分隔。比如510116|双流区这样能避免全国同名区域的混淆。去年我做重庆项目时就遇到过坑直接输入江北区结果获取到的是宁波的江北区数据。3.2 POI分类的精准定位方法POI分类编码表采用三级分类体系建议根据分析精度灵活选择大类如餐饮服务适合快速概览中类如中餐厅平衡精度与覆盖面小类如川菜馆精准定位有个实用技巧是在Excel中使用筛选功能先定位大类再逐步缩小范围。比如找教育类POI时路径是科教文化服务→教育培训→中小学辅导。对于不确定的分类可以到高德地图APP上搜索目标场所查看其详情页的分类标签。4. 实战演示获取成都市火锅店POI全流程现在我们来个完整案例获取成都市所有火锅店数据。打开插件窗口后城市名填写510100|成都市adcode中文名双保险POI类型直接输入火锅店小类最精准密钥粘贴事先申请好的Key数据源选择提前创建好的空数据源数据集命名为成都火锅店_202405点击确定后进度条开始走动。这里要注意观察日志窗口如果出现配额不足提示说明当天额度用尽需要更换Key或次日再试。成功后会生成包含十几个字段的数据集其中以下字段最有分析价值name店铺名称address详细地址tel联系电话location经纬度坐标5. 数据可视化与坐标纠偏5.1 快速制作热力图技巧将数据添加到地图后右键选择创建专题图→热力图。关键参数设置半径像素建议设为30-50太小会碎片化太大会过度平滑色带选择红-黄-蓝渐变最能体现密度差异记得勾选使用权重字段用店铺评分字段作为权重值5.2 火星坐标转换的必须操作高德返回的坐标是经过加密的GCJ-02坐标系俗称火星坐标直接叠加到WGS84底图上会有300-500米的偏移。解决方法有两个使用SuperMap的坐标转换工具选择高德转WGS84预设方案更精准的做法是用控制点配准在插件生成的POI数据中选取5-6个明显特征点如大型商场正门与卫星图上真实位置手动匹配我通常采用第二种方法虽然麻烦但精度能达到5米以内。特别是在做商业选址分析时50米的偏差都可能导致完全错误的结论。转换后的数据建议另存为新数据集命名时加上_WGS84后缀以示区分。6. 进阶应用场景与性能优化6.1 定时自动更新POI库的秘诀对于需要持续监控的场景如竞品店铺动态可以结合SuperMap的定时任务功能实现自动化将上述操作保存为工作空间在任务调度模块设置每周执行一次配合Python脚本自动对比新旧数据集差异我在某连锁便利店扩张项目中就用这个方法成功捕捉到3家新开业的竞争对手比他们的市场调研团队发现得还早两周。6.2 大规模采集的性能优化当需要采集全省或全国数据时要注意按地级市分批请求避免单次查询范围过大设置每次请求间隔2-3秒防止触发反爬机制使用多Key轮询策略准备5-6个Key交替使用有个取巧的方法是利用行政区划边界数据先做空间筛选比如只采集某条主干道两侧500米范围内的POI。这需要先用SuperMap的缓冲区分析工具生成目标区域面再作为空间条件传入插件。

更多文章